SO WHAT IS BIM?
7
Building
Information
Modelling
Building should be taken as the verb to build rather the noun a building
M covers two interchangeable aspects -Modelling and Management
Information flow throughout the life cycle of an asset from procurement through operational management and changes

MODEL SEGREGATION - VOLUMESVolumesThe volume strategy should be owned and managed at the highest level of the projectmanagement team. Use of volumes enables concurrent work on models, information security, file size and other key information activities tasks to be managed effectively.All members of the design team shall agree volumes as fully as possible at the start of a project and document within the BEP.
